Vintage Explained

Vintage and retro are often used interchangeably to describe things from the past, but they actually have different meanings.

Vintage refers to something that is from a previous era, usually 20 to 100 years old. Vintage items are often associated with high quality, craftsmanship, and timelessness.

Retro, on the other hand, refers to something that imitates a style or design from the past, but is not necessarily old. Retro items often have a nostalgic feel, and are often associated with a particular era or time period. For example, a Metallica print t-shirt, may imitate a style or design from the past, giving it a nostalgic feel but is actually from the current era and therefore considered retro. But it isn't the same as a Metallica t-shirt made in 1989 from one of their concert which is actually from that era and can therefore be considered vintage.

In summary, vintage refers to items that are actually from a previous era, while retro refers to new items that are designed to imitate a previous era's style or design.

Product that are labled as "vintage," means that the item is from a previous era and is at least 20 years old to our best knowledge and authenticity checks. The dates indicated on the product are the year of original publication, not just a reprint. This means that the product is an authentic item from the past and not a modern reproduction.

When a product is labeled as vintage, it usually means that it has some historical or nostalgic value. Vintage items are associated with high quality, craftsmanship, and timelessness, and are often sought after by collectors and enthusiasts.

We try our best to authenticate vintage pieces, which are at least 20 years old and offer them to you. It might happen that some items are little younger or older than indicated, as the exact date is sometimes very hard or impossible to find out.
